Janice Eberly is a scholar working on Economics and Econometrics, Finance and Strategy and Management. According to data from OpenAlex, Janice Eberly has authored 38 papers receiving a total of 2.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 31 papers in Economics and Econometrics, 17 papers in Finance and 6 papers in Strategy and Management. Recurrent topics in Janice Eberly’s work include Economic theories and models (16 papers), Economic Growth and Productivity (15 papers) and Capital Investment and Risk Analysis (10 papers). Janice Eberly is often cited by papers focused on Economic theories and models (16 papers), Economic Growth and Productivity (15 papers) and Capital Investment and Risk Analysis (10 papers). Janice Eberly collaborates with scholars based in United States, Canada and Philippines. Janice Eberly's co-authors include Andrew B. Abel, Avinash Dixit, Robert S. Pindyck, Stavros Panageas, Nicolas Crouzet, Jan A. Van Mieghem, Arvind Krishnamurthy, Nicolas Vincent, Sérgio Rebelo and Neng Wang and has published in prestigious journals such as The Journal of Finance, American Economic Review and The Quarterly Journal of Economics.
